The contract requires the implementation and ongoing maintenance of CMMC Level 2 compliance to securely handle Controlled Unclassified Information, aligning with all NIST SP 800-171 security controls. This includes establishing and documenting policies and procedures to protect sensitive data, ensuring proper access controls, system integrity, and continuous monitoring. The contractor must also be fully prepared for a third-party assessment by a C3PAO, demonstrating adherence to all required controls through evidence, training records, and audit trails. Incident reporting protocols must be in place to promptly identify, document, and respond to cybersecurity events in accordance with federal guidelines, ensuring no lapse in compliance or data exposure. O-RING
Solicitation # SPE7L1-26-T-973E
Solicitation SPE7L1-26-T-973E is a request for quotations issued by DLA Land and Maritime for the procurement of 124 O-rings, identified as NSN 5331012199072. This is designated as a critical application item and is identified as a commercial product. Approved sources include Honeywell International Inc and Boeing Distribution Services X, Inc, both utilizing part number 2670890-8. The required delivery date is February 1, 2027, with a need ship date of January 20, 2027, and a delivery lead time of 145 days. Shipping is FOB Origin, with inspection and acceptance occurring at the destination, specifically the DLA Distribution DDSP New Cumberland Facility in Pennsylvania. The contract mandates strict quality and packaging standards, including compliance with MIL-STD-129 for marking and RP001 for palletization. Due to the risk of ultraviolet deterioration, items must be sealed in medium duty, waterproof, greaseproof, opaque bags per MIL-DTL-117. Special marking code 20, indicating do not bend, is required. Quality assurance follows MIL-STD-1916 or ASQ H1331, with an acceptance threshold of zero non-conformances in the sample lot. Administrative requirements include the use of the Wide Area WorkFlow system for invoicing and adherence to Buy American and Berry Amendment restrictions. All quotes must be submitted via the DLA Internet Bid Board System.
